## Environments

RelayForge runs three environments: sandbox, staging, and production. Failed exports are retried automatically in all three, but with different backoff and attempt limits, so test plugins against sandbox first. Retry behavior is not configurable from plugin code. In production, your plugin runs under the following retry configuration values:

settings of tagef-bawif:
DRUIX_HOST=druix.zemvarlabs.internal
DRUIX_PORT=8000

Welcome to the Relaykit team! Since you'll be reviewing the broker upgrade PRs, here's the quick context: we're moving Quillbus from the 3.x line to 4.2, which changes how consumer groups rebalance. Most diffs you'll see touch the ack-timeout config and the retry topic naming. Don't sweat the big generated schema files — focus on the handler changes in the dispatch module. Torin wrote up the full migration rationale, rollback plan, and the gotchas we hit in staging on the internal page below.

wiki page, tahaf-tajog: https://jira.ordindyn.corp/pipeline

Handover note — Threshwick transcoding farm

Taking over from me: the farm is stable after last month's codec upgrade. Queue depth alarms are tuned; anything over 400 jobs pages on-call. GPU nodes in the Fennridge cluster drain automatically before maintenance windows. Release manager should hold deploys during peak ingest (evenings). For the next release, the workers run with the following configuration values.

service settings:
[casax]
port = 6379
team = rusir
host = casax.zemvarhq.corp
region = outer-4
access_code = ac_9808ce
timeout_ms = 1500

Finance Review Summary — Board

Regional sales, Q3, Ostrane Foods. The Marrow Valley region beat plan by 7%; Kelder Coast missed by 4% on delayed listings. Overall revenue up 3% year-on-year, with mix shifting toward the Solba range. Receivables remain within policy. Full schedules are filed with the audit pack. The confidential outlook underpinning these figures appears below.

board note of bahaf-kahif: Gross margin on Wenael came in at 10 percent against a plan of 15 percent. Only 7 of the 120 pilot accounts renewed Wenael, so a churn review is set for July 1.